15:43
ОбновитьСмайлыУправление мини-чатом
МИНИ-ЧАТ
Главная страница!

 



 
          





Рекомендуем:





Последние Файлы GTA 4 Последние Файлы GTA-MP Реклама
Скрипт GTA 4 элементы Watch... 07.09.2014
Ferrari 360 Spider [EPM con... 13.12.2013
Porsche Cayenne Turbo 2012 ... 13.12.2013
Shelby Terlingua Mustang v1... 13.12.2013
Hamann Lamborghini Gallardo... 27.10.2013
[GM] The Big PEN1:LS v2.00 ... 04.12.2017
Dgun (AvnanceRP,SampRP,Dimo... 19.03.2016
SAMP скрипт SX Events (MySQ... 03.03.2016
Карта ASL мэрия для SAMP се... 03.03.2016
AIM для SA-MP 0.3.7 22.02.2016
  • Страница 1 из 3
  • 1
  • 2
  • 3
  • »
Модератор форума: Alcoholik  
Pick`UP
DarkZevsДата: Среда, 10.12.2008, 22:58 | Сообщение # 1
Новенький
Группа: Продвинутые
Сообщений: 40
Награды: 1
Город: Kiev
Репутация: 4
Замечания: 0%
Статус:
Как зделать вход в участок СФ
Подскажите плз.



[GM]VitrualLife v0.1 100% - REALISE
[GM]VirtualLife v0.2 100% - REALISE
[GM]GodFather v1.0 23%
VientoДата: Четверг, 11.12.2008, 04:19 | Сообщение # 2
Освоившийся
Группа: Продвинутые
Сообщений: 118
Награды: 6
Город: Madrid
Репутация: -65
Замечания: 0%
Статус:
if (PlayerToPoint(4.0, playerid,-1605.5358,711.5519,13.8672))// - ||2 -
{
SetPlayerInterior(playerid, 6);
SetPlayerVirtualWorld(playerid,0);
SetPlayerPos(playerid, 247.2678,63.6050,1003.6406);
PlayerInfo[playerid][pInt] = 6;
PlayerInfo[playerid][pLocal] = 150;(плокал уже сам смотри, я написал 150-ый к примеру.)
GameTextForPlayer(playerid, "~w~San Fierro Police Department", 5000, 1);
return 1;
}
Выход в том же духе.



Lead Administration team of my beautiful life.
LynchДата: Четверг, 11.12.2008, 18:23 | Сообщение # 3
Местный
Группа: Продвинутые
Сообщений: 720
Награды: 11
Город: Губкин
Репутация: 288
Замечания: 60%
Статус:
Ну еще же надо pickup поставить
theAloneДата: Четверг, 11.12.2008, 18:38 | Сообщение # 4
Долгожитель
Группа: Пользователи
Сообщений: 1380
Награды: 1
Город: Москва
Репутация: 92
Замечания: 0%
Статус:
Lynch, необязательно. То, что дал Trust_, сделать таймер, и если игрок оказывается у входа, то его портит. Пикапы занимают много места.
TimeДата: Четверг, 11.12.2008, 18:42 | Сообщение # 5
Группа: I'm V.I.P.
Сообщений: 352
Награды: 13
Город: Samp-Rus.Com
Репутация: 308
Замечания: 0%
Статус:
Помоему так проще и надёжней !

1. Добавляем в спислок new в самый низ строчки:

new Policeenter;
new Policeexit;

2. Потом добавляем в паблик OnGameModeInit строчки:

Policeenter = CreatePickup(1239,23,-1942.094848, 2379.372802, 49.703125);//Сдесь привязваем пикапы, координаты красным это вход
Policeexit = CreatePickup(1239,23,-228.934432, 1401.197509, 27.765625);// Аналогично выход пикапа

3. Далее добавляем в паблик OnPlayerPickUpPickup следующие строчки:

if(pickupid == Policeenter) // Сдесь привязка к пикапу входа
{
SetPlayerInterior(playerid, 18);// Сдесь указываеш интерьер
SetPlayerPos(playerid,-225.846847, 1410.457275, 27.773437);// А сдесь координаты
}
if(pickupid == Policeexit)// Пикап привязки на выход
{
SetPlayerInterior(playerid, 0);// Если на улице то 0
SetPlayerPos(playerid,-1938.217651, 2376.203857, 49.695312);// Координаты
}
return 1;

Я лично так делаю ! P.S. Если кому то помогло ставте +


[cut=Работы на SRC][FS]Sud v3.0
[FS]AdminHouse 2008 year
[MAP]PlaceDM
[MAP]DeathRace
[MAP]Ресторан, место отдыха
[MAP]Aвто-Базар[/cut]
[cut=Информация по ICQ]Если вы хотите приобрести ICQ 6dig, красивую или простую пишем мне в ICQ о цене договоримся, имеются inv,clear. Жду в ICQ в общем ;)[/cut]

DarkZevsДата: Четверг, 11.12.2008, 20:43 | Сообщение # 6
Новенький
Группа: Продвинутые
Сообщений: 40
Награды: 1
Город: Kiev
Репутация: 4
Замечания: 0%
Статус:
кто может дать координаты участка СФ буду благодарен.


[GM]VitrualLife v0.1 100% - REALISE
[GM]VirtualLife v0.2 100% - REALISE
[GM]GodFather v1.0 23%
LynchДата: Четверг, 11.12.2008, 20:54 | Сообщение # 7
Местный
Группа: Продвинутые
Сообщений: 720
Награды: 11
Город: Губкин
Репутация: 288
Замечания: 60%
Статус:
Quote (DarkZevs)
кто может дать координаты участка СФ буду благодарен.

/save для чего?

Добавлено (11.12.2008, 20:48)
---------------------------------------------
ща сделаю с тебя + будет

Добавлено (11.12.2008, 20:54)
---------------------------------------------
все подставил, осталось только в мод вставить, с тебя +
[pwn]1. Добавляем в спислок new в самый низ строчки:

new Policeenter;
new Policeexit;

2. Потом добавляем в паблик OnGameModeInit строчки:

Policeenter = CreatePickup(-1605.2153,710.7626,13.8672, 49.703125);//Сдесь привязваем пикапы, координаты красным это вход
Policeexit = CreatePickup(246.5667,63.3072,1003.6406, 27.765625);// Аналогично выход пикапа

3. Далее добавляем в паблик OnPlayerPickUpPickup следующие строчки:

if(pickupid == Policeenter) // Сдесь привязка к пикапу входа
{
SetPlayerInterior(playerid, 6);// Сдесь указываеш интерьер
SetPlayerPos(playerid,246.5667,63.3072,1003.6406);// А сдесь координаты
}
if(pickupid == Policeexit)// Пикап привязки на выход
{
SetPlayerInterior(playerid, 0);// Если на улице то 0
SetPlayerPos(playerid,-1605.2153,710.7626,13.8672);// Координаты
}
return 1;[/pwn]

Prizrak1379Дата: Суббота, 28.03.2009, 20:04 | Сообщение # 8
Освоившийся
Группа: Пользователи
Сообщений: 76
Награды: 3
Город: ls
Репутация: -10
Замечания: 80%
Статус:
Time, а как нибуть можно сделать чтобы в эти интериеры входил командой /enter а выходил /exit если да скажите плиз как ато я недопераю
LlamaДата: Суббота, 28.03.2009, 20:29 | Сообщение # 9
Постоялец
Группа: I'm V.I.P.
Сообщений: 326
Награды: 8
Город: Москва
Репутация: 268
Замечания: 60%
Статус:
Убираеш стандартные пикапы в OnGameModinit с помощью DisableInteriorEnterExits();(вписываеш туда эту строку)
и делаеш следующие:

[pwn]
в /enter:
if (PlayerToPoint(3.0, playerid,-311.2880,1303.4868,53.6643)) // то, от куда писать /enter
{
SetPlayerInterior(playerid,6);
SetPlayerPos(playerid,238.6620,141.0520,1003.0234);
GameTextForPlayer(playerid, "~w~Welcome to the SFPDt", 5000, 1);
PlayerInfo[playerid][pInt] = 6;
PlayerInfo[playerid][pLocal] = 235;
}
Затем в /exit:

else if (PlayerToPoint(3.0, playerid,238.6620,141.0520,1003.0234)) //то, от куда писать /exit
{
SetPlayerInterior(playerid,0);
SetPlayerPos(playerid,-311.2880,1303.4868,53.6643);//куда игрок выйдит
PlayerInfo[playerid][pInt] = 0;
PlayerInfo[playerid][pLocal] = 255;
}

добовляем пикап:
AddStaticPickup(1318, 2, -311.2880,1303.4868,53.6643); //координаты /enter


Далее, делаем чтоб при заходе игроку писалось что да как... Вставлять примерно в 25-27000 строку..:

else if (PlayerToPoint(3, i,-311.2880,1303.4868,53.6643))//координаты /enter
{
GameTextForPlayer(i, "~y~Welcome to the ~r~SFPD~n~~w~Type /enter to go in", 5000, 5);
}
[/pwn]

Там, где выделенно красным ставим свои координаты)
Ставим плюсег )))




Сообщение отредактировал Llama - Суббота, 28.03.2009, 20:54
Prizrak1379Дата: Суббота, 28.03.2009, 21:57 | Сообщение # 10
Освоившийся
Группа: Пользователи
Сообщений: 76
Награды: 3
Город: ls
Репутация: -10
Замечания: 80%
Статус:
мне ошибку выдает
C:\Documents and Settings\Prizrak\Рабочий стол\Новая папка\Новая папка\gamemodes\Spack.pwn(13559) : error 029: invalid expression, assumed zero
C:\Documents and Settings\Prizrak\Рабочий стол\Новая папка\Новая папка\gamemodes\Spack.pwn(13559) : warning 215: expression has no effect
C:\Documents and Settings\Prizrak\Рабочий стол\Новая папка\Новая папка\gamemodes\Spack.pwn(13559) : error 001: expected token: ";", but found "if"
C:\Documents and Settings\Prizrak\Рабочий стол\Новая папка\Новая папка\gamemodes\Spack.pwn(27227) : warning 203: symbol is never used: "gCopPlayerSpawns"
Pawn compiler 3.2.3664 Copyright © 1997-2006, ITB CompuPhase

2 Errors.

Добавлено (28.03.2009, 21:57)
---------------------------------------------

Quote (Llama)
Далее, делаем чтоб при заходе игроку писалось что да как... Вставлять примерно в 25-27000 строку..: else if (PlayerToPoint(3, i,-311.2880,1303.4868,53.6643))//координаты /enter { GameTextForPlayer(i, "~y~Welcome to the ~r~SFPD~n~~w~Type /enter to go in", 5000, 5); }

вот это можно узнать куда вставлять по подробнее mda

Drago_JekaДата: Суббота, 28.03.2009, 22:20 | Сообщение # 11
Группа: I'm V.I.P.
Сообщений: 754
Награды: 41
Город: Где-то там...
Замечания: 0%
Статус:
Quote (Prizrak1379)
else if (PlayerToPoint(3, i,-311.2880,1303.4868,53.6643))//координаты /enter { GameTextForPlayer(i, "~y~Welcome to the ~r~SFPD~n~~w~Type /enter to go in", 5000, 5); }

[offtop]public CustomPickups() вроде сюда[/offtop] :)


LlamaДата: Суббота, 28.03.2009, 22:20 | Сообщение # 12
Постоялец
Группа: I'm V.I.P.
Сообщений: 326
Награды: 8
Город: Москва
Репутация: 268
Замечания: 60%
Статус:
Quote (Prizrak1379)
вот это можно узнать куда вставлять по подробнее

public CustomPickups()

Строку выложи, где ошибки


Prizrak1379Дата: Суббота, 28.03.2009, 22:24 | Сообщение # 13
Освоившийся
Группа: Пользователи
Сообщений: 76
Награды: 3
Город: ls
Репутация: -10
Замечания: 80%
Статус:
вставил всеравно тоже самоей даж еще больше их стало
[offtop]
C:\Documents and Settings\Prizrak\Рабочий стол\Новая папка\Новая папка\gamemodes\Spack.pwn(13545) : error 029: invalid expression, assumed zero
C:\Documents and Settings\Prizrak\Рабочий стол\Новая папка\Новая папка\gamemodes\Spack.pwn(13545) : warning 215: expression has no effect
C:\Documents and Settings\Prizrak\Рабочий стол\Новая папка\Новая папка\gamemodes\Spack.pwn(13545) : error 001: expected token: ";", but found "if"
C:\Documents and Settings\Prizrak\Рабочий стол\Новая папка\Новая папка\gamemodes\Spack.pwn(25672) : error 029: invalid expression, assumed zero
C:\Documents and Settings\Prizrak\Рабочий стол\Новая папка\Новая папка\gamemodes\Spack.pwn(25672) : warning 215: expression has no effect
C:\Documents and Settings\Prizrak\Рабочий стол\Новая папка\Новая папка\gamemodes\Spack.pwn(25672) : error 001: expected token: ";", but found "if"
C:\Documents and Settings\Prizrak\Рабочий стол\Новая папка\Новая папка\gamemodes\Spack.pwn(25672) : error 017: undefined symbol "i"
C:\Documents and Settings\Prizrak\Рабочий стол\Новая папка\Новая папка\gamemodes\Spack.pwn(25672) : fatal error 107: too many error messages on one line

Compilation aborted.Pawn compiler 3.2.3664 Copyright © 1997-2006, ITB CompuPhase

6 Errors.

LlamaДата: Суббота, 28.03.2009, 22:26 | Сообщение # 14
Постоялец
Группа: I'm V.I.P.
Сообщений: 326
Награды: 8
Город: Москва
Репутация: 268
Замечания: 60%
Статус:
У нас собрание телепатов? Строки в студию crazy


DarkMarkДата: Суббота, 28.03.2009, 22:27 | Сообщение # 15
Уверенный в себе
Группа: Продвинутые
Сообщений: 284
Награды: 10
Город: СПБ
Репутация: 7
Замечания: 100%
Статус:
Prizrak1379, скнь строку 13545, 25672
  • Страница 1 из 3
  • 1
  • 2
  • 3
  • »
Поиск:





 


 


 
Хостинг от uCoz samp.at.ua